She mentioned France and how they don't allow Taser's there because they kill people. I did some checking and she's wrong.

France

Tasers are used by the French National Police and Gendarmerie. In September 2008, they were made available to local police by a government decree,[SUP][49][/SUP] but in September 2009, the Council of State reversed the decision judging that the specificities of the weapon required a stricter regulation and control.[SUP][50][/SUP] However, since the murder of a policewoman on duty, the Taser is in use again by local police forces in 2010.
